Australian Open

The year kicks off with the prestigious Australian Open, one of the four Grand Slam tournaments, held annually in Melbourne. Players from all over the globe will compete for the coveted title.

Roland Garros

Roland Garros, also known as the French Open, will take place in Paris, showcasing the best clay-court tennis matches. Fans can expect intense rallies and incredible performances from top players.

Wimbledon

Wimbledon, the oldest tennis tournament in the world, held at the All England Club in London, is a highlight of the 2026 ATP Schedule. Players will compete on grass courts in this prestigious event.

US Open

The final Grand Slam event of the year, the US Open, will take place in New York City. Tennis fans can look forward to witnessing thrilling matches and exceptional talent on the hard courts.

Grand Slam Locations

The Grand Slam tournaments are the most coveted events in the ATP calendar. In 2026, these four major tournaments will take place in iconic locations: Wimbledon in London, UK, Roland Garros in Paris, France, Australian Open in Melbourne, Australia, and US Open in New York, USA.

Masters 1000 Series Venues

The Masters 1000 tournaments are crucial in the ATP season. These events are held in various cities worldwide. In 2026, some of the confirmed venues include Indian Wells in California, USA, Monte Carlo in Monaco, and Shanghai in China.

Other ATP Tour Locations

Aside from the Grand Slam and Masters 1000 events, the ATP tour includes numerous other tournaments hosted in different cities around the globe. These locations provide unique experiences for players and fans alike, such as Madrid in Spain, Tokyo in Japan, and Vienna in Austria.
